From 167d5e33fcb821e51e2f9dcf460591737c3c7972 Mon Sep 17 00:00:00 2001 From: "Peter S. Mazinger" Date: Tue, 3 Jan 2006 14:50:18 +0000 Subject: Complete split of all the string functions. Hope haven't broken too much. wcscoll/strcoll needs some love ... --- libc/string/_syserrmsg.h | 35 +++++++++++++++++++++++++++++++++++ 1 file changed, 35 insertions(+) create mode 100644 libc/string/_syserrmsg.h (limited to 'libc/string/_syserrmsg.h') diff --git a/libc/string/_syserrmsg.h b/libc/string/_syserrmsg.h new file mode 100644 index 000000000..efb7a1d59 --- /dev/null +++ b/libc/string/_syserrmsg.h @@ -0,0 +1,35 @@ +/* + * Copyright (C) 2002 Manuel Novoa III + * Copyright (C) 2000-2005 Erik Andersen + * + * Licensed under the LGPL v2.1, see the file COPYING.LIB in this tarball. + */ + +#ifndef __SYSERRMSG_H +#define __SYSERRMSG_H 1 + +/**********************************************************************/ +/* NOTE: If we ever do internationalized syserr messages, this will + * have to be changed! */ + +#if defined(__mips__) || defined(__sparc__) +/* sparce and mips have an extra error entry, as EDEADLK and EDEADLOCK have + * different meanings on those platforms. */ +# define _SYS_NERR 126 +#else +# define _SYS_NERR 125 +#endif + +#ifdef __UCLIBC_HAS_ERRNO_MESSAGES__ +# define _SYS_ERRMSG_MAXLEN 50 +#else /* __UCLIBC_HAS_ERRNO_MESSAGES__ */ +# define _SYS_ERRMSG_MAXLEN 0 +#endif /* __UCLIBC_HAS_ERRNO_MESSAGES__ */ + +#if _SYS_ERRMSG_MAXLEN < __UIM_BUFLEN_INT + 14 +# define _STRERROR_BUFSIZE (__UIM_BUFLEN_INT + 14) +#else +# define _STRERROR_BUFSIZE _SYS_ERRMSG_MAXLEN +#endif + +#endif -- cgit v1.2.3